(7) CH0/CH1 Send Command
When a menu is selected, a command to control the PID module is sent.
Control:

Enable/Disable the control to the PID module.

AT/Auto-reset:

Perform auto-tuning (AT)/auto-reset or cancel auto-tuning (AT).

Manual Mode:

Enable manual/auto mode.

External SP Input (CH0 only):

Enable/Disable the external SP input.

Program Control:

Run/Stop the program control, advance next/previous step, or hold/run the
program control.


(8) CH0/CH1 Status Indicators
Control:

Turns green while the control of CH0/CH1 is enabled

AT:

Turns green while auto-tuning (AT) is performed for CH0/CH1.

Manual:

Turns green while CH0/CH1 is in the manual control.

External (CH0 only):

Turns green while the external SP input is enabled.

Program (Program control only): Turns green while CH0/CH1 is in program control mode.
HOLD (Program control only): Turns green while the program control of CH0/CH1 is held.
WAIT (Program control only):

Turns green while the program wait is functioning for CH0/CH1.


(9) CH0/CH1 Error Indicators
PARAM:

Turns red while parameter range error is occurring.

LOOP:

Turns red while loop break alarm is turned on.

UP:

Turns red while the input is over range.

DOWN:

Turns red while the input is under range.

A1 to A8:

Turns red while the corresponding alarm is turned on.


(10) Monitor Settings
Click on Monitor Settings button to open the PID Module Monitor Settings dialog box.

(11) Monitor
Click on Monitor button to start monitoring and tracing the PID module.
